Message from Director General of Central Industrial Security Force
I am happy to learn that the Gujarat Police is organizing the 53rd All India Police Duty Meet at Gandhinagar (Gujarat) from 02nd to 09th February, 2010.
The Duty Meet is of enormous significance from professional standpoint as it gives an opportunity to police personnel to update and hone their skills and knowledge in specialized areas of police work in their quest for excellence. The Duty Meet also gives an opportunity to the police personnel of State and Central Police Organizations to meet and interact with each other in a spirit of healthy competition and camaraderie.
I extend my warm felicitations to all the participants and my good wishes to the organizers for the success of the Duty Meet.
N.R. Das
Director General of Central Industrial Security Force
